Minutes — Management Meeting, Headcount Planning

Attendees: K. Orvath, L. Pennell, S. Durai.

The committee reviewed next year's headcount proposal in detail. Twenty-two net additions approved pending finance validation; the Quillmere support team expansion was deferred to mid-year. Contractor conversions will be assessed case by case. Finance will model both scenarios. The underlying rationale is recorded in the note below.

board note of baweg-bawig: Project Tamath slips by six weeks because of the audit delay.

Minutes — Management Meeting, Fennwick Industries. The committee reviewed pricing for the Brightline tool range. Mr. Odell presented margin analysis showing the mid-tier model underpriced against cost trends. A 6% adjustment was provisionally approved, pending finance validation of competitor data from the Hallmere survey. Final schedules due next week. The confidential plan note follows:

confidential, fahag-yahap: Project Raleth slips by six weeks because of the tooling delay.

**Ticket SW-188: Retention sweeper skips tombstoned partitions**

The Grimsby sweeper marks partitions for deletion but never revisits ones tombstoned during a prior crashed run. Result: stale data past the retention window. Repro: kill the sweeper mid-pass, restart, observe skipped set. New folks: check the scheduler log first. Affected build noted below.

trace token, fafog-kageg: htk4_98e6